Guest guest Posted December 11, 2007 Report Share Posted December 11, 2007 Thus Spake The Lord More effulgent than the Sun, whiter and purer than snow, subtler than ether, the Paramatma dwells in all, permeating the entire Cosmos, shining in every atom. You are in the Brahman. The Brahman is in you. You are that Brahman. And that Brahman is you. What greater truth can I convey to you? Man is held to be a tool, an instrument, and not born as primarily for his own fulfillment. Each man has to educate himself through trials and errors and attain graduation by reaching the full knowledge of his own reality. He has a great destiny and he is equipped with the skills needed to achieve that destiny. He is not a helpless victim of circumstances. But the tragedy is that he has allowed the equipment to rust through neglect and he has forgotten the goal. The road he has to traverse is also grown with brambles and the signboards have disappeared. That is why the person who laid the road has come again to lead man along it, after repairs and renewals. Reference: Sathya Sai Speaks, Vol. XXI, P. 42-51. Sathya Sai Speaks, Vol. VI, P. 215-217.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
